First thing I'd do is to pull the front rack,pop the front panel and see if you have a Ducati Ignition(has a combo cdi and coil) If you do this needs to be replaced with a #2202602 Kokusan ignition kit. Changeover on the ignitions happened after 2/23/2003 build date,but still could be a few Ducati systems still out there. OPT

Well that's one good thing in your favor! You do have the Kokusan ignition system. You said its been sitting up and you cleaned the carb,but only sparks when you hold the ignition switch on. If battery is new and fully charged,I'd check all connections,plus pull the stator cover and check if any moisture/rust is around the flywheel or pick up coil. Could just need to be cleaned up. If this doesn't help then you may need to check the switch wiring out. Doesn't happen often,but ignition switches can short out also. OPT

OPT checked the stator evry thing was ok. but stumbled on the problem. my battery was weak and had the charger on it trying to crank this thing and from messing with cars i decided to put a car battery on the 4wheeler battery for jump and run and fired ok. so now i have new battery on the way hope problem is fixed. thanks for all ur help. AND ANYONE WITH FIRING PROBLEMS MAKE SURE U HAVE GOOD BATTERY BEFORE ANY DIGNOSTICS IT WILL SAVE U LOT OF TIME DONT DO LIKE I DID THINKING BATTERY CHARGER WOULD DO THE JOB
